‘The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ping’ teaser has arrived

In The Hunger Games movies, Haymitch Abernathy (Woody Harrelson) was a troubled mentor, ravaged by years of trauma and alcoholism. The Hunger Games: Sunrise at the Reaping takes viewers back 24 years to Haymitch’s youth, when he was paid homage to in the Fiftieth Hunger Games, also known as the Second Quarter Quell.

teaser for The Hunger Games: Sunrise at the Reaping Joseph Zada ​​is introduced in the role of young Haymitch. But sharp eyes will also spot some other familiar figures from Jennifer Lawrence’s Hunger Games movies. Playing gamemaker Plutarch Heavensbee, Jesse Plemons takes over the role originated by the late Philip Seymour Hoffman. Elle Fanning appears as a young Effie Trinket, originally portrayed by Elizabeth Banks. Ralph Fiennes steps into the role of President Snow, who was first played by the late Donald Sutherland, and then by Tom Blythe in the prequel. The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es. Kieran Culkin as Caesar Flickerman (formerly Stanley Tucci) and Maya Hawke as Virus (formerly Amanda Plummer) are not seen in this trailer.

The cast also includes Glenn Close, Mckenna Grace, Whitney Peak, Iris Apatow, Kelvin Harrison Jr. and Ben Wang. Director Francis Lawrence, who has directed every Hunger Games film so far, is once again taking charge and Billy Ray is on board as screenwriter.

The Hunger Games: Sunrise at the Reaping Will be released in theaters on November 20, 2026.
